Ingredients

For the Broccoli

  • 1 head of broccoli
  • 2 tablespoons butter (melted)
  • 1 clove garlic (minced)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ese (freshly grated)
  • Additional Parmesan cheese for serving
  • Pinch of red pepper flakes (optional)

Step 1: Preheat Your Air Fryer

Preheat your air fryer to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. This step ensures that your broccoli cooks evenly and achieves that desired crispiness.

Step 2: Prepare the Broccoli

  • Cut the broccoli into florets and set them aside in a mixing bowl.

Step 3: Mix Ingredients

  • In the same mixing bowl, combine melted butter, minced garlic, sal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es (if using).
  • Add the broccoli florets to this mixture and toss until evenly coated.

Step 4: Add Parmesan Cheese

  • Sprinkle in the freshly grated Parmesan cheese.
  • Mix again to ensure all pieces are well-coated with cheese.

Step 5: Air Fry the Broccoli

  • Place the prepared broccoli into the air fryer basket in an even layer.
  • Cook for 6-8 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through cooking to promote even browning.

Step 6: Serve Immediately

Once done, carefully remove the broccoli from the air fryer. Serve immediately while hot, topped with additional Parmesan cheese if desired.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

It’s important to ensure your Air Fryer Broccoli turns out perfectly crispy and flavorful. Here are some common mistakes to avoid:

  • Skipping the Preheat: Not preheating your air fryer can lead to uneven cooking. Always preheat for best results.
  • Overcrowding the Basket: Filling the air fryer basket too much prevents proper airflow. Cook in batches for even crispiness.
  • Neglecting Seasoning: Under-seasoning broccoli can make it bland. Don’t forget to season well with salt, pepper, and any additional spices.
  • Using Cold Ingredients: Cooking straight from the fridge can affect cooking time and texture. Allow ingredients to come to room temperature for better results.
  • Ignoring Cooking Time: Cooking for too long can cause burning. Keep an eye on the broccoli and shake the basket halfway through.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Storage Duration: Store cooked Air Fryer Broccoli in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
  • Container Type: Use an airtight container to maintain freshness and prevent moisture loss.
  • Cooling Time: Allow the broccoli to cool down completely before sealing it in a container.

Freezing Air Fryer Broccoli

  • Freezing Duration: Freeze cooked broccoli for up to 2-3 months for optimal taste.
  • Container Type: Use freezer-safe bags or containers, removing as much air as possible before sealing.
  • Thawing Tips: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ating.

Reheating Air Fryer Broccoli

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 10 minutes until heated through.
  • Microwave: Place in a microwave-safe dish, cover, and heat in 30-second intervals until warm.
  • Stovetop: Heat a skillet over medium heat with a splash of water, then add the broccoli until warmed through.
